CEL Critical Power is a global provider of mission-critical power solutions operating at the center of the AI, hyperscale data center and critical infrastructure ecosystem. An Irish-based manufacturer, distributor and exporter of electrical switchgear, controls and related products with over 40 years of experience, CEL is now firmly focused on supplying the global data center industry at scale. Operating from our 500,000 sq. ft. manufacturing facility in Williamsburg, Virginia, we aim to double in size each year for the next three years.

Role Purpose

Reporting to the Service Manager, the Circuit Breaker Test Technician is responsible for the testing, inspection, troubleshooting and documentation of low-voltage and medium-voltage circuit breakers used in critical power and data center applications.

Scope of Accountability

  • Electrical testing of low-voltage and medium-voltage circuit breakers
  • Primary and secondary injection testing
  • DLRO (Digital Low Resistance Ohmmeter) and insulation resistance testing
  • Troubleshooting and fault identification
  • Test documentation and reporting
  • NFPA 70E compliance

Electrical Testing & Inspection

  • Perform LV and MV breaker testing
  • Primary injection testing
  • Secondary injection testing
  • Contact resistance (DLRO) testing
  • Insulation resistance testing
  • Trip-time and coil testing

Troubleshooting & Documentation

  • Identify and document deficiencies
  • Review results against acceptance criteria
  • Maintain complete test records

Safety & Compliance

  • Follow NFPA 70E practices
  • Use PPE
  • Follow LOTO procedures

Experience

  • 2+ years of electrical, commissioning, testing or related experience
  • Experience testing LV/MV breakers preferred
  • Military electrical experience valued

Qualifications

High school diploma or equivalent required. NETA certification preferred not required.

Skills & Competencies

Circuit breaker testing, troubleshooting, electrical schematics, documentation, safety compliance.
